wind, blow her braided hair just a little bit further
watch as they sway in your breathe as they swayed, she wept
don’t cry willow dry your eyes willow
the wind whispers now, sweet songs love songs
that flow off the birds tongues.
how they say you are not alone
how they make your branches their home
as tears roll down her bark she says
in winter when you fly the leaves
on my branches die and i am left a lone again.
don’t cry willow dry your eyes willow
then out of a den crawled a furry friends
Mrs. fox and her three little cubs how they
howled at the wind and sang to willow their love
with your trunk you've made for us a shelter
you protect us from both beast and bad weather
if it were not for you where would me and my babies be
and as willow remembered the past she said
they will grow old and your will leave me
don’t cry willow dry your eyes willow
as Mr. farmer came to find some shade from the sun
he saw how low her weeping willow's hung
and so he thought to cheer her up with a song
as the breeze blew and the fox howled he begun
in the winter when i am cold to you alone do i go
for your wood I’m given heat even
the bed post where i sleep
in the summer you are my cover
from the rays shining in the days
and with a broken smile she replied
as flattering as this may be, your axe hurts me.
don’t cry willow dry your eyes willow
Mr. willow can never be your's
because he’s in his yard and you are in your's.
